An advertising agency is a specialized service provider that helps businesses create, plan, and execute advertising campaigns. These agencies offer a range of services, including market research, creative development, media planning, and buying, as well as campaign management and performance analysis. By leveraging their expertise and industry knowledge, advertising agencies aim to enhance brand awareness, drive sales, and achieve marketing goals for their clients.

An advertising agency offers a wide range of services designed to help businesses promote their products or services effectively. Here are the key functions they perform:

Market Research: Advertising agencies conduct comprehensive market research to understand the target audience, competitors, and market trends. This information helps in crafting effective advertising strategies.

Creative Development: Agencies create compelling advertisements, including visuals, copy, and overall campaign concepts. This includes designing print ads, creating TV commercials, developing online ads, and more.

Media Planning and Buying: They plan and purchase media slots across various platforms, such as TV, radio, print, and digital media, ensuring that the ads reach the right audience at the right time.

Campaign Strategy: Advertising agencies develop strategic plans to achieve specific marketing goals. This involves deciding the best mix of media channels and scheduling ads for maximum impact.

Branding: They help businesses develop and maintain a strong brand identity, including logo design, brand messaging, and overall brand strategy.

Digital Marketing: Agencies manage online advertising efforts, including search engine marketing (SEM), social media advertising, email marketing, and display advertising.

Public Relations: Some advertising agencies also offer PR services, managing a company's public image and handling media relations.

Performance Analysis: Agencies track and analyze the performance of advertising campaigns to measure effectiveness and ROI. They use this data to optimize future campaigns.

Consulting and Strategy: They provide expert advice on marketing strategies and help businesses navigate the complexities of the advertising landscape.

By providing these services, advertising agencies help businesses reach their target audiences, enhance brand visibility, and drive sales growth.

When considering hiring an advertising agency, it's important to understand the various pricing models and factors that influence costs. Here's a breakdown of what you can expect when budgeting for advertising services:

Types of Advertising & Agency Hourly Rates

Advertising agencies offer a variety of services across different mediums, each with its own pricing model and rate. Here's a detailed look at common advertising types and their average hourly rates:

ServiceDescriptionCommon Ad PlatformsAverage Hourly Rate
Pay-per-click (PPC) AdvertisingAdvertisers pay a fee every time their ad is clicked. Costs vary based on bid competition.Google Ads, Microsoft Ads, Quora$100โ€“$149
Social Media AdvertisingPaid ads served through social media platforms, charged based on impressions or clicks.Facebook, Twitter, TikTok, Instagram, LinkedIn, YouTube, Pinterest$100โ€“$149
Over the Top (OTT) AdvertisingVideo ads on streaming services, charged based on CPMs.Disney+, Hulu, Netflix, Paramount+, Peacock, HBO Max$50โ€“$99
Connected TV (CTV) AdvertisingVideo ads on connected devices, targeted using demographic info, charged based on CPMs.Roku, Apple TV, Fire TV$50โ€“$99
TV AdvertisingPay for a TV ad slot based on CPM, varying by market, channel, time of day, and season.ABC, NBC, FOX, CBS$100โ€“$149
Radio AdvertisingPrices vary by market, genre, audience, and time of day, charged by estimated CPM.AM & FM Radio, Sirius Radio, Spotify, Pandora, Podcasts$150โ€“$199
Print AdvertisingCharged based on publication readership, ad size, and placement location.Newspapers, Magazines, Brochures, Direct Mailers$100โ€“$149
Out-of-Home (OOH) AdvertisingOutdoor ads viewed outside the home, charged weekly or monthly based on duration and format.Billboards, Bench ads, Transit ads, Wayfinding ads$100โ€“$149
Email MarketingAds within email newsletters, charged based on circulation and audience.The Assist, The Daily Upside, Morning Brew, NYTโ€™s The Morning$100โ€“$149

Advertising Agency Pricing Models

Agency fees for managing advertising campaigns are separate from the costs of running the ads themselves. These fees can be structured in various ways, including:

  • Hourly Rates: Typically range from $100 to $150 per hour.
  • Monthly Retainers: Fixed amount paid each month for a package of services.
  • Project-Based Fees: Flat fee for the entire project, suitable for specific campaigns.
  • Performance-Based Pricing: Charges based on results achieved, such as the number of leads generated.

Factors Influencing Costs

Several factors can influence how much an advertising agency charges for their services:

  • Agency Size: Larger agencies often charge more due to their prestige and extensive resources.
  • Location: Agencies in major cities or high-cost areas generally charge higher rates.
  • Ad Channel: Costs vary based on the type of advertising (e.g., PPC vs. TV ads).
  • Experience: Agencies with a proven track record may justify higher fees.
  • Industry: Some industries, like legal or healthcare, are more expensive to advertise in due to higher competition.

Hiring an advertising agency can be a game-changer for your business, offering numerous benefits that can elevate your marketing efforts and drive significant growth. Here are some compelling reasons why you should consider partnering with an advertising agency:

Expertise and Experience: Advertising agencies bring a wealth of knowledge and experience to the table. Their teams consist of professionals who specialize in various aspects of marketing, from creative design to media planning and data analysis. This expertise ensures that your campaigns are crafted and executed with precision, maximizing your return on investment.

Access to Cutting-Edge Tools and Technology: Agencies have access to the latest marketing tools and technologies, which can be expensive and complex for individual businesses to acquire and manage. These tools help in optimizing campaigns, analyzing performance, and ensuring that your advertising dollars are spent efficiently.

Creative Excellence: A key advantage of working with an advertising agency is their ability to produce high-quality, creative content that resonates with your target audience. From compelling ad copy to visually stunning graphics and videos, agencies have the creative talent to make your brand stand out.

Cost Efficiency: While hiring an agency involves a financial investment, it can ultimately save you money. Agencies can negotiate better rates with media outlets due to their established relationships and bulk buying power. Additionally, they can help you avoid costly mistakes that can occur when managing campaigns in-house.

Time Savings: Managing an advertising campaign is time-consuming and requires constant attention. By outsourcing this task to an agency, you can free up your time to focus on other critical aspects of your business, such as product development, customer service, and operations.

Strategic Planning and Execution: Agencies develop comprehensive marketing strategies tailored to your business goals. They conduct thorough market research, identify target audiences, and create a detailed plan to reach them effectively. This strategic approach ensures that your campaigns are aligned with your overall business objectives.

Measurable Results: Advertising agencies provide detailed reports and analytics, allowing you to track the performance of your campaigns. They use data-driven insights to make informed decisions and adjustments, ensuring that your marketing efforts continuously improve and deliver results.

Scalability: Whether youโ€™re looking to launch a small, local campaign or a large, national one, agencies have the resources and expertise to scale your efforts accordingly. This flexibility is particularly beneficial for businesses planning to expand their reach and grow their market presence.

Industry Insights: Agencies keep a pulse on industry trends and consumer behavior, providing valuable insights that can inform your marketing strategies. This knowledge helps you stay ahead of the competition and adapt to changing market dynamics.

Comprehensive Services: Many advertising agencies offer a full range of services, including digital marketing, social media management, public relations, and more. This integrated approach ensures that all aspects of your marketing are cohesive and working towards the same goals.

In summary, hiring an advertising agency can provide your business with the expertise, resources, and strategic direction needed to create effective marketing campaigns. This partnership can lead to improved brand awareness, higher customer engagement, and increased sales, making it a worthwhile investment for businesses of all sizes.

Choosing the right advertising agency for your business is a crucial decision that can significantly impact your marketing success.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you find the best agency that aligns with your goals and needs:

Define Your Goals: Clearly outline your advertising objectives. Are you looking to increase brand awareness, generate leads, boost sales, or launch a new product? Understanding your goals will help you find an agency that specializes in the services you need.

Assess Your Budget: Determine how much you are willing to spend on advertising. This includes not only the agency fees but also the ad spend for your campaigns. Having a clear budget will help you narrow down your options and find an agency that fits within your financial constraints.

Research Agencies: Start by compiling a list of potential agencies. Look for agencies with a strong reputation, positive client reviews, and a proven track record of success. Check their websites, case studies, and social media profiles to get a sense of their expertise and style.

Evaluate Their Expertise: Make sure the agency has experience in your industry or with similar businesses. An agency with relevant experience will better understand your market and be able to create more effective campaigns.

Check Their Range of Services: Determine what services you need (e.g., digital marketing, TV advertising, social media management) and ensure the agency offers these services. A full-service agency can provide a comprehensive approach, while a specialized agency might excel in a specific area.

Review Their Creative Portfolio: Look at the agencyโ€™s past work to assess their creativity and quality. Their portfolio should demonstrate their ability to produce engaging and effective advertisements that align with your brandโ€™s aesthetic and message.

Ask About Their Process: Understand the agencyโ€™s approach to developing and executing campaigns. Ask about their process for research, strategy development, creative execution, and performance measurement. A transparent and well-structured process is a good indicator of professionalism.

Meet the Team: Arrange a meeting with the team who will be handling your account. Itโ€™s important to feel comfortable with them and confident in their abilities. Assess their communication style, responsiveness, and enthusiasm for your project.

Discuss Metrics and Reporting: Inquire about how the agency measures the success of their campaigns. They should provide clear metrics and regular reports to track progress and ROI. Make sure their reporting methods align with your expectations.

Check References: Ask the agency for references from past or current clients. Contact these clients to get firsthand feedback on their experience, the agencyโ€™s performance, and the results they achieved.

Evaluate Their Network and Resources: Determine if the agency has strong relationships with media outlets, influencers, and other industry partners. A well-connected agency can leverage these relationships to enhance your campaigns.

Consider Their Cultural Fit: Assess whether the agencyโ€™s values, work ethic, and company culture align with your own. A good cultural fit can lead to a more productive and enjoyable working relationship.

Review Their Contract Terms: Carefully review the agencyโ€™s contract terms, including fees, deliverables, timelines, and termination clauses. Ensure you understand all terms and are comfortable with the commitment.

Discuss Their Approach to Innovation: Ask how the agency stays updated with industry trends and innovations. An agency that embraces new technologies and methodologies can keep your campaigns ahead of the curve.

Look for Transparency and Honesty: Choose an agency that is transparent about their capabilities and honest about what they can achieve. Avoid agencies that make unrealistic promises or guarantees.

Assess Their Problem-Solving Skills: Discuss potential challenges and how the agency would handle them. Their problem-solving approach should align with your expectations and show their ability to adapt and overcome obstacles.

Evaluate Their Collaboration Style: Determine how the agency collaborates with clients. They should be open to feedback, willing to work closely with your team, and flexible in their approach.

Consider Long-Term Potential: Think about whether the agency can grow with your business. A good agency should be able to scale their services and adapt to your evolving needs.

Ask About Their Training and Development: Inquire about how the agency invests in the professional development of their team. An agency that prioritizes training is likely to stay at the forefront of industry trends and best practices.

Trust Your Instincts: Finally, trust your instincts. Choose an agency that you feel confident in and excited to work with. A strong partnership is built on mutual trust and respect.

By following these steps, you can find an advertising agency that not only meets your needs but also contributes significantly to your marketing success.

When selecting an advertising agency, it's crucial to ask the right questions to ensure they are the best fit for your business needs. Here are some key questions to guide you through the evaluation process:

What experience do you have in our industry? Understanding if the agency has relevant experience in your industry can help ensure they are familiar with your market dynamics and target audience.

Can you share case studies or examples of past campaigns? Reviewing their past work will give you insight into their creative capabilities and the results they have achieved for similar clients.

What services do you offer? Confirm that the agency provides the full range of services you require, such as digital marketing, social media advertising, TV commercials, and print media.

How do you approach campaign strategy and planning? This question helps you understand their process for developing advertising strategies and how they tailor their approach to meet client goals.

Who will be working on our account? It's important to know the team members who will handle your campaigns, including their experience and roles.

How do you measure the success of your campaigns? Ensure the agency uses clear metrics and KPIs to track performance and provide regular reports on campaign progress.

What is your pricing model? Clarify their pricing structure, whether itโ€™s hourly rates, monthly retainers, or project-based fees, and ensure it aligns with your budget.

Can you provide references from past or current clients? Speaking with references can provide valuable insights into the agency's reliability, communication, and effectiveness.

How do you stay updated with industry trends and innovations? An agency that keeps up with the latest trends and technologies is more likely to deliver cutting-edge campaigns.

What tools and technologies do you use? Knowing the tools and platforms the agency utilizes can help gauge their efficiency and technological capabilities.

How do you handle campaign adjustments and optimizations? Understand their process for making real-time adjustments to improve campaign performance.

What are your expectations from us as a client? This helps set clear expectations for collaboration, communication, and feedback throughout the partnership.

How do you manage budgets and ad spend? Ensure the agency has a strategy for effectively managing your ad budget to maximize ROI.

What is your creative process? Learn about their approach to brainstorming, developing, and refining creative concepts for your campaigns.

How do you ensure our brandโ€™s voice and message are consistent? Confirm that the agency has a plan to maintain brand consistency across all advertising channels.

Can you handle multi-channel campaigns? If you plan to advertise across various platforms, make sure the agency can manage integrated campaigns seamlessly.

What is your policy on client confidentiality and data security? Ensure the agency has measures in place to protect your confidential information and data.

How do you handle feedback and revisions? Understand their process for incorporating client feedback and making necessary adjustments to campaigns.

What is your typical turnaround time for campaign development? Knowing their timelines will help you plan your marketing activities and set realistic deadlines.

Do you offer any guarantees or performance incentives? Some agencies might offer performance-based incentives or guarantees, which can align their success with your business goals.

By asking these questions, you can thoroughly evaluate potential advertising agencies and choose the one that best aligns with your business objectives and expectations.
